Webb26 aug. 2024 · Time of use tariffs, or TOUs, encourage customers to use energy at off-peak times. The TOU flexible tariff offers people cheaper electricity prices when demand and energy prices are at their lowest. Off-peak times will vary depending on your location and meter type, but typically are at night or weekends. cfwin10设置烟雾头Webb7 okt. 2024 · Peak (Weekdays 4pm – 8pm): This is when electricity is in peak demand and therefore most expensive. Peak rates in Queensland generally cost around 33 to 35 cents per kWh. Off-peak (10pm – 7am): This is when demand for power is lower and electricity usage rates are cheapest.
